Sherwood Dust Extraction Systems for Cleaner and Healthier Woodworking
Effective dust extraction is an essential part of any woodworking workshop, helping to create a cleaner, safer and more productive environment. Every cutting, sanding, routing and machining operation generates wood chips and fine airborne dust that can affect visibility, machine performance and air quality. A well-designed dust extraction system captures waste at the source, making workshop clean-up easier while helping to protect both your equipment and your workspace.
Sherwood dust extraction systems are designed to suit a wide range of woodworking applications, from portable power tools through to larger stationary machinery. Whether you're connecting a table saw, thicknesser, jointer, bandsaw or drum sander, selecting the right extractor, hose size and filtration system helps maximise airflow and collection efficiency. Quality filtration is particularly important for capturing fine dust particles that are often invisible but remain suspended in the air long after machining has finished.
Regular maintenance helps ensure your dust extraction system continues operating at peak performance. Emptying collection bags or bins before they become full, cleaning filters, inspecting hoses for leaks or blockages and checking seals will all help maintain airflow and extend the life of the equipment. Combined with good workshop practices, an efficient dust extraction system contributes to cleaner machinery, improved machining accuracy and a healthier environment for every woodworking enthusiast.
FAQs
Why is dust extraction important in a woodworking workshop?
Dust extraction removes wood chips and fine airborne dust generated during machining. This improves workshop cleanliness, enhances visibility, supports machine performance and helps create a healthier working environment.
What types of woodworking machines can be connected to a dust extraction system?
Dust extraction systems can be connected to table saws, bandsaws, jointers, thicknessers, drum sanders, routers, spindle sanders, mitre saws and many other woodworking machines that produce wood dust and shavings.
How do cyclone separators improve dust extraction?
Cyclone separators remove larger chips and debris before they reach the main filter, helping maintain suction, reducing filter maintenance and increasing collection efficiency during extended use.
How often should dust extractor filters be cleaned?
Filters should be inspected regularly and cleaned or replaced according to the manufacturer's recommendations. Clean filters maintain stronger airflow and improve the system's ability to capture fine airborne dust.
Does hose diameter affect dust extraction performance?
Yes. Using the correct hose diameter for your machinery helps maintain efficient airflow. Larger stationary machines typically require larger hoses, while portable tools often perform best with smaller-diameter connections.
Can one dust extraction system service multiple machines?
Yes. Many workshops connect multiple machines to a single dust collector using ducting and blast gates. Opening only the blast gate for the machine in use helps maintain maximum airflow and extraction efficiency.
What maintenance helps keep a dust extraction system performing efficiently?
Regularly emptying collection containers, cleaning filters, checking for air leaks, inspecting hoses for blockages and ensuring ducting remains clear will help maintain strong suction and reliable performance.
